If conditional is true and it’s_____ is true, then the conclusion is true

1 Answer

5 votes

Answer:

hypothesis

Explanation:

The statement "if p, then q" is a conditional statement.

p----->is the hypothesis

q----->is the conclusion

This conditional is true if it's hypothesis true and the conclusion is true.

This is just one out three situations for which the conditional is true.
